Guests who stay at the 4-star Beijing Mijia International Hotel can park their car on site.
This hotel is located within a 39-minute drive of Beijing Daxing International airport and 4.5 km from Beijing Technology and Business University. Liangxiangduo Pagoda is a 10-minute ride from the accommodation in Beijing. There is Fangshan Haotian Tower a 10-minute ride from the hotel.